Pinkalicious finds herself in a dilemma when she realizes she does not have a festive outfit for the school's Holiday Sweater Day, leading her to take matters into her own hands with a DIY project. Through Pinkalicious's journey, the story explores themes of creative problem solving, resourcefulness, and the pride that comes from making something yourself. It is perfectly pitched for the preschool and early elementary years, offering a gentle model for how to handle a minor social crisis with imagination rather than frustration. Parents will appreciate how it encourages children to look at everyday items as craft supplies and promotes a spirit of festive joy that is more about effort than expensive purchases.
